a={}
n=10
c=0
for i=1,n do
  table.insert(a,tonumber(io.read()))
end
for i=1,(#a-1) do
  for g=1,#a do
    if a[g]==a[i] then c=c+1 end
  end
end
f=io.open('out','w')
io.write(f,tostring(c)..'\n')
io.close(f)
ругается так:

lua: file.lua:13: bad argument #1 to 'write' (string expected, got userdata)
stack traceback:
	[C]: in function 'write'
	file.lua:13: in main chunk
	[C]: in ?
ЧЯДНТ?
sirocco
# systemctl disable lxdm.service
# systemctl enable lightdm.service

вот где собака зарыта! спасибо.
sirocco
noober
[[email protected] ~]$ ls -l /etc/systemd/system/default.target
ls: невозможно получить доступ к /etc/systemd/system/default.target: Нет такого файла или каталога

А вот так?
$ ls -l /etc/systemd/system/
[email protected] ~]$  ls -l /etc/systemd/system/
итого 0
lrwxrwxrwx 1 root root  46 янв  8 19:18 dbus-org.freedesktop.NetworkManager.service -> /usr/lib/systemd/system/NetworkManager.service
lrwxrwxrwx 1 root root  57 янв  8 19:18 dbus-org.freedesktop.nm-dispatcher.service -> /usr/lib/systemd/system/NetworkManager-dispatcher.service
lrwxrwxrwx 1 root root  36 янв  8 19:17 display-manager.service -> /usr/lib/systemd/system/lxdm.service
drwxr-xr-x 2 root root  88 янв  8 17:53 getty.target.wants
drwxr-xr-x 2 root root 120 янв  8 19:18 multi-user.target.wants
[[email protected] ~]$
sirocco
Проверяем
$ ls -l /etc/systemd/system/default.target

Если видим
/etc/systemd/system/default.target -> /usr/lib/systemd/system/graphical.target

То
# rm /etc/systemd/system/default.target

и потом
# systemctl enable lightdm.service

https://wiki.archlinux.org/index.php/Display_Manager

[[email protected] ~]$  ls -l /etc/systemd/system/default.target
ls: невозможно получить доступ к /etc/systemd/system/default.target: Нет такого файла или каталога
vasek
noober
Loaded: loaded (/usr/lib/systemd/system/lightdm.service; disabled)
Значит systemctl is-enabled lightdm.service выдаст - disabled
lightdm.service у тебя не активирован.
А почему не срабатывает - $ sudo systemctl enable lightdm - не понятно
Это, конечно, ерунда, должно работать и без этого, но чтобы исключить лишнее, попробуй набрать полностью
$ sudo systemctl enable lightdm.service
и потом проверь вывод - systemctl is-enabled lightdm.service

[[email protected] ~]$ sudo systemctl enable lightdm.service
Failed to issue method call: File exists
[[email protected] ~]$ sudo systemctl is-enabled lightdm.service
disabled
[[email protected] ~]$
vadik
noober
проблемы только при включении сервиса, если что, ручной запуск lightdm проходит хорошо.
Это вы сейчас зачем написали?
чтобы с иксами не было никаких вопросов.
vadik
lightdm не пользуюсь, но подозреваю, что он должен вести логи. Смотрите в /var/log. Заодно гляньте в /var/log/Xorg.0.log. Вдруг у вас Х-ы падают а не lightdm.

Только, для чистоты эксперимента, остановите и отключите сервис, удалите лог lightdm, включите сервис, перезагрузите систему, скопируйте содержимое лога.
проблемы только при включении сервиса, если что, ручной запуск lightdm проходит хорошо.
vasek
А чтот говорит
systemctl status lightdm.service
[[email protected] ~]$ systemctl status lightdm.service
lightdm.service - Light Display Manager
   Loaded: loaded (/usr/lib/systemd/system/lightdm.service; disabled)
   Active: active (running) since Чт 2014-01-09 17:07:35 MSK; 1h 52min ago
     Docs: man:lightdm(1)
 Main PID: 321 (lightdm)
   CGroup: /system.slice/lightdm.service
           ├─321 /usr/bin/lightdm
           └─329 /usr/sbin/X :0 -auth /run/lightdm/root/:0 -nolisten tcp vt1 ...
[[email protected] ~]$
не использую я этот plymouth, свистелки не люблю.
Lupo_Alberto
Возможно, у вас его и не должно быть. У меня дисплейный менеджер KDM, так он его и создаёт при включении. Думал с lightdm будет аналогично.
А что тогда в самом файле сервиса написано (это, наверное, /usr/lib/systemd/system/lightdm.service)?
[[email protected] ~]$ cat /usr/lib/systemd/system/lightdm.service
[Unit]
Description=Light Display Manager
Documentation=man:lightdm(1)
[email protected]
After=systemd-user-sessions.service [email protected] plymouth-quit.service
[Service]
ExecStart=/usr/bin/lightdm
Restart=always
IgnoreSIGPIPE=no
BusName=org.freedesktop.DisplayManager
[Install]
Alias=display-manager.service
[[email protected] ~]$